Understanding Asbestos and Its Dangers
Asbestos is a naturally happening mineral that was widely used in building and construction, shipbuilding, and different markets due to its heat resistance and insulating homes. Although its efficiency was commonly acknowledged, the risks of asbestos exposure eventually emerged. [Asbestos Exposure In Louisiana](https://opensourcebridge.science/wiki/Undisputed_Proof_You_Need_Louisiana_Asbestos_Exposure_Attorney) fibers, when inhaled or ingested, can result in serious health concerns, consisting of:
DiseaseDescriptionAsbestosisA chronic lung disease triggered by asbestos fibers causing lung scarring.MesotheliomaAn uncommon cancer impacting the lining of the lungs, abdominal area, or heart, mostly triggered by asbestos exposure.Lung CancerA kind of cancer that affects lung function, typically linked to asbestos exposure amongst smokers.Pleural ThickeningIrregular thickening of the pleura, the lining around the lungs, that can restrict breathing.Legal Representation for Asbestos-Related Illnesses

What are the indications of asbestos-related illnesses?
Typical indications of asbestos-related diseases may consist of persistent cough, shortness of breath, chest pain, and tiredness. If you have a history of asbestos exposure, it's essential to consult a physician if you experience any of these signs.
2. How long do I have to sue in Louisiana?
Louisiana has a statute of restrictions that normally enables victims to file claims within one year from the date of diagnosis or the date of death for wrongful death claims. It is necessary to act rapidly and seek the help of an attorney to guarantee your claim is submitted on time.
3. Can I still pursue a claim if I was exposed decades ago?
Yes, even if exposure occurred years earlier, victims may still have a right to seek compensation if they were detected with an asbestos-related illness. The specific circumstances surrounding the exposure will figure out the practicality of a claim.
4. What types of compensation can I get?
Victims may be entitled to compensation for medical expenditures, lost earnings, discomfort and suffering, and other damages resulting from their illness. The amount of compensation differs significantly depending on the specifics of each case.
5. What if the accountable party is no longer in business?
Oftentimes, injured parties can file claims against trust funds developed by business that went insolvent due to asbestos-related claims. An experienced attorney can help navigate these complicated legal landscapes.
